JAG: The Prisoner Airdate: May 8, 1996. While on a weekend leave in Hong Kong, JAG's maritime law expert, Harm, is kidnapped and taken to a prison in China for interrogation. The Chinese want to know what recommendation he would be making to the American government as a course of action in the event the Chinese decide to take back two of their former provinces. Under the influence of drugs, Harm is led to believe that there is a prisoner in the cell below his, and that it is his father. He is given a choice: information in exchange for his father. As Harm fights desperately to ascertain what is real and what is not, his captors use the information he inadvertently gives them about his childhood to add substance to the illusion, even to the extent of carving the initials "HR2" - as Harm Sr. had done on their last outing together - on the wall of the cell. Meanwhile, Meg and Krennick use all their resources, including blackmail, to find and rescue Harm. This
episode gives us Harm's birthdate, October 25, 1963, and Social Security
Number, 989-54-8301.
